2. Years provider has delivered service: 5
3. Evidence that services have been effective: Improvements in scores on standardized reading and math assessment
4. Title of the instructional program, curriculum series to be used (if appropriate): WIN WorkKeys Instructional Solution
5. Grade level(s) the provider will serve: 6 - 12
6. Content area(s) provider will serve: Reading and Math
7. Number of sessions provided per week, if applicable: 2
8. Average length of each service session (minutes/hours): 30 minutes
9. Duration of the available service period (e.g. September 1 – June 30; September 1 – August 31; weekends only; summer school only; specific number of weeks or hours, other, etc;): Year round
10. Type of instruction: Guided instruction using self-paced independent distance learning modules
11. Qualifications of the service provider(s)/instructor(s): Certified teachers involved in supervision and delivery
12. Reports to parents, teachers, and LEA (Content, frequency, method of delivery): Monthly report
